方法 说明
使用更多数据 在有条件的前提下,尽可能多地获取训练数据是最理想的方法,更多的数据可以让模型得到充分的学习,也更容易提高泛化能力
使用更大批次 在相同迭代次数和学习率的条件下,每批次采用更多的数据将有助于模型更好的学习到正确的模式,模型输出结果也会更加稳定
调整数据分布 大多数场景下的数据分布是不均匀的,模型过多地学习某类数据容易导致其输出结果偏向于该类型的数据,此时通过调整输入的数据分布可以一定程度提高泛化能力
调整目标函数 在某些情况下,目标函数的选择会影响模型的泛化能力,如目标函数​在某类样本已经识别较为准确而其他样本误差较大的侵害概况下,不同类别在计算损失结果的时候距离权重是相同的,若将目标函数改成​则可以使误差小的样本计算损失的梯度比误差大的样本更小,进而有效地平衡样本作用,提高模型泛化能力
调整网络结构 在浅层卷积神经网络中,参数量较少往往使模型的泛化能力不足而导致欠拟合,此时通过叠加卷积层可以有效地增加网络参数,提高模型表达能力;在深层卷积网络中,若没有充足的训练数据则容易导致模型过拟合,此时通过简化网络结构减少卷积层数可以起到提高模型泛化能力的作用
数据增强 数据增强又叫数据增广,在有限数据的前

提高网络泛化能力,过拟合相关推荐

  1. 机器学习中模型泛化能力和过拟合现象(overfitting)的矛盾、以及其主要缓解方法正则化技术原理初探...

    1. 偏差与方差 - 机器学习算法泛化性能分析 在一个项目中,我们通过设计和训练得到了一个model,该model的泛化可能很好,也可能不尽如人意,其背后的决定因素是什么呢?或者说我们可以从哪些方面去 ...

  2. 集成学习算法的思想、通过集成学习提高整体泛化能力的前提条件、如何得到独立的分类器Bagging、Boosting、Stacking算法

    集成学习算法 Ensemble learning algorithm 目的:让机器学习的效果更好,单个的分类器如果表现的好,那么能不能通过使用多个分类器使得分类效果更好呢?或者如果单个分类器分类效果不 ...

  3. 【深度学习】常见的提高模型泛化能力的方法

    前言 模型的泛化能力是其是否能良好地应用的标准,因此如何通过有限的数据训练泛化能力更好的模型也是深度学习研究的重要问题.仅在数据集上高度拟合而无法对之外的数据进行正确的预测显然是不行的.本文将不断总结 ...

  4. CNN网络泛化能力--Why Deep Nets Generalize?

    http://www.inference.vc/everything-that-works-works-because-its-bayesian-2/ Why do Deep Nets General ...

  5. 提高模型泛化能力的几大方法

    作者:OpenMMLab 链接:https://www.zhihu.com/question/540433389/answer/2629056736 来源:知乎 著作权归作者所有.商业转载请联系作者获 ...

  6. AI体统中提高模型泛化能力的两个思路

    近几天做模式识别实验时遇到了一个问题.在A环境下采集的数据所训练出的模型,在B环境下几乎丧失了识别能力.很明显,该模型的泛化能力太差. 考虑两个思路:第一,在不同的环境中采集多组数据重新模型训练,以此 ...

  7. 卷积神经网络学习路线(五)| 卷积神经网络参数设置,提高泛化能力?

    前言 这是卷积神经网络学习路线的第五篇文章,主要为大家介绍一下卷积神经网络的参数设置,调参技巧以及被广泛应用在了哪些领域,希望可以帮助到大家. 卷积神经网络的参数设置 这个举个例子来说是最好的,因为直 ...

  8. 如何提高强化学习算法模型的泛化能力?

    深度强化学习实验室 官网:http://www.neurondance.com/ 来源:https://zhuanlan.zhihu.com/p/328287119 作者:网易伏羲实验室 编辑:Dee ...

  9. 如何提高神经网络的泛化能力?八大要点掌握

    提高神经网络的泛化能力 1. 使用更多数据 在有条件的前提下,尽可能多地获取训练数据是最理想的方法,更多的数据可以让模型得到充分的学习,也更容易提高泛化能力. 2. 使用更大批次 在相同迭代次数和学习 ...

最新文章

  1. 一台机器上启动多个tomcat
  2. ngx_http_redis_module配置使用
  3. shell中的变量赋值
  4. sklearn模型评估
  5. 读书笔记2013第3本:《无价》
  6. 1 io口 stm32_从STM32分享各种硬件以及总线之GPIO简介
  7. GitHub 标星 1.6w+,我发现了一个宝藏项目,推荐大家学习
  8. PyTorch 1.0 中文文档:torch.hub
  9. python 输入一个列表s和一个由二元组成的列表p_re --- 正则表达式操作 — Python 3.9.1 文档...
  10. 关于《趣谈网络协议》的读书笔记
  11. 什么是MXF文件?将MXF转为MP4格式的方法
  12. NRF24L01+模块:一对一双向通信,成功!
  13. NTC热敏电阻应用-测温
  14. 基于AD5933 生物复阻抗
  15. 跨站点设置 Cookie
  16. 今日头条的排名算法_今日头条旗下悟空问答的排名算法规则
  17. Git 版本回退方法
  18. 办公室计算机联机,两台电脑怎样联机?
  19. uniapp获取云服务空间 数据
  20. php图片写入带问号_关于编码:PHP输出显示带有问号的黑色小菱形

热门文章

  1. 阿里 c语言开发工程师,阿里巴巴2014秋季校园招聘软件研发工程师笔试题
  2. 大学四年一路走来,我把这些私藏的算法学习工具全贡献出来了!
  3. LinkedList集合基本操作(代码+注释)
  4. R语言绘图中图片的组合(cowplot、patchwork宏包、layout、par()、gridExtra)
  5. 134个治病小偏方,从此不用去医院 - 健康程序员,至尚生活!
  6. [转贴]李雅轩杨式太极拳精论
  7. 2021-11-02发电机转子方程的推导
  8. 根据“建筑标高”生成“结构标高”
  9. 【Benewake(北醒) 】长距 TF03 100m/180m介绍以及资料整理
  10. 单接口测试(场景测试)